>  I think I see what is wrong. The mac addresses are different. I don't
>  understand how that can be. Maybe there are two places to read the
>  mac address from and linux gets it right and we get it wrong.
>  
>  christos

i just scanned the whole /24 here, the MAC addresses NetBSD figures out 
are not known on the net -- so no collisions may occur when it really 
'uses' them. however, it seems it doesn't even get that far.

would it be of any help making the appropriate source more verbose to 
see what happens (or not)?
